Day 12: ACT. Every December 6th, Remember. On Dec 6, 1989, 14 women were murdered during the antifeminist #MontrealMassacre. The Canadian government later declared Dec 6 a National Day of Remembrance & Action on Violence Against Women. #16Days#ListenLearnAct#December6

LISTEN. Acknowledge the problem. Perth County 2022: 2,077 Shelter Crisis Calls, 564 DV Calls to Police. These don’t fully represent total number of victims in Perth County & across Canada. In Canada, 70% of DV victims haven’t spoken to any support services #16Days#ListenLearnAct
